Take an Olympic-inspired staycation in UK locations

-

Top sportsmen and women from across the world will take part in The 2021 Olympic Games in Tokyo this summer, so why not get into the spirit of it all with an Olympics inspired trip in the UK.

Keen cyclists could try a mountain biking campervan holiday in the South Downs – from £104 pn with Yescapa.

A mountain biking adventure by campervan allows you to strap on bikes, get on the road and park up wherever the terrain looks appealing. The limestone gravel paths and hills of the 160km South Downs Way are made for off-road biking. Your home is Nellie, a converted Ford LWB based in Crawley, with kitchen, bike rack for four bikes, camping table and chairs, and awning. The cost for seven nights is £732 including one insured driver, breakdown cover and up to 100 km mileage per day. Flexible cancellati­on policy up to 48 hours in advance. Bike hire not included. Or Go for Gold with London’s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park Tours, led by a Blue Badge Tourist Guide.

A profession­ally guided tour of the park is available as a private itinerary, or customised for special interest groups. Hear how this part of East London was transforme­d to host the iconic event, view the London Stadium, and visit sites such as the London Aquatics Centre and Lee Valley VeloPark, and pose for pics next to the Olympic Rings.

A half-day tour costs from £176 per group, comprising up to 30 people. To book, visit www.toursof201­2sites.com.

Tee off on a championsh­ip, original Victorian golf course at Luton Hoo – from £50 pp

One of the longest 18-hole championsh­ip golf courses in the UK, the Luton Hoo Hotel course spans 7,107 yards of inland links and parkland. The par 73 course has hosted top events, and offers six holes with water hazards, as well as a driving range, putting green and chipping green. Tuition is offered with resident PCA Golf Profession­al Craig Ferris. Tee slots costs start from £50 pp while tuition is from £60 pp. Call Luton Hoo on 01582 734437 (www.lutonhoo.co.uk).

Have a smashing time at Thurleston­e – from £100 pp with Pride of Britain Hotels

Badminton became an official sport at the Barcelona 1992 Olympic Games, and the Thurleston­e Hotel’s facilities include a large indoor badminton hall. It has two pools, tennis courts, a spa and a nine-hole par three golf course, and is close to many beaches. Stay overnight in October from £200 per room/£100 pp including breakfast. Holidays for horses, hounds and humans – Shropshire from £134 pp with Canine Cottages

Hopton Gate House (sleeps six) is one of several properties that accommodat­e guests, dogs and horses too, in a Shropshire hamlet with views.

There’s room for up to three horses, with full livery available. Explore on horseback before heading to historic Ludlow (4.5 miles away). A seven-night, self-catering stay costs from £134 pp (£801 total) plus £20 supplement for a dog. Visit Canine Cottages (www.caninecott­ages.co.uk).
